Monday, December 04, 2006


Ellica is an electric car project run by Keio University.
I saw it parked in front of Tokyo Gymnasium near our office.
Ellica Website


1 comment:

Anonymous said...

Cool car, it's inbetween a car from Thunderbirds and a Citroen DS. I remember seeing all the different cars when I visited Tokyo. Lowered mini vans everywhere!!